This video shows the assembly of the mold egg-crate structure from the CNC-cut parts for the MIT Hyperloop 2 shell tooling. After the egg-crate assembly, I rip some (lots of!) poplar strips and strip-plank the mold dry. Finally the strips are glued together with thickened epoxy and given an initial fairing job with a grinder and some 36 grit sandpaper.
